Dell announces the XPS 15 with the stunning Infinity Display

Computex 2015 is going on in its full force in Taiwan with many manufacturers launching new Windows-based devices. Earlier this year at the CES 2015, Dell introduced the stunning XPS 13 bezel-less laptop boasting a resolution of 3,200 by 1,800 pixels. At the trade show in Taiwan, Dell introduced a bigger version of the laptop, the Dell XPS 15 (via The Verge).

The details about the laptop are scarce at the moment, but it’s going to be among the wide range of Windows 10 devices which are expected to launch later this year with the new operating system.

As far as the internals are concerned, it’s not too far-fetched to assume that Dell XPS 15 will come with top-notch specifications, likely the same as the Dell XPS 13. Dell didn’t reveal any detail about its exact availability or pricing, but rest assured, it’s not going to be a cheap offering.
